Blood-red light shone in from the window and fell on Lin Sheng's feet.

He held the Wooden Shield in one hand and the Great Sword in the other, standing in front of the security door in the living room.

He planned to go out.

After staying in this dream home for so long, Lin Sheng finally could not stand the snail's speed of cultivation.

He needed more actual combat to absorb more souls!

There was also this dream home. What exactly was there in the strange and unknown environment outside?

He was very curious.

This time, he was really determined to open the door and go out to explore the surroundings.

Pa.

Lin Sheng leaned the Great Sword against the wall, emptied his hand, grabbed the door handle, and gently turned it.

Click.

The door opened.

Lin Sheng quickly let go and held the Great Sword again.

He gently pushed open the security door with his foot.

Outside the door was a dark stairwell.

There was no light in the stairwell, only the red light from his own house.

In the stairwell, in front of the security door opposite, there was a person standing.

It was a tall and thin man in white clothes.

He was standing in front of the security door with his back facing Lin Sheng, and seemed to be taking out the key to open the door.

But what made Lin Sheng feel strange was that the man's body did not move at all.

From the moment he saw the man, the man had been in the same posture.

He was like a statue, standing in front of the opposite door, motionless.

Squeak …

When the security door of Lin Sheng's house was opened to a certain degree, it would make a faint sound of metal rubbing.

This time was no exception. The sound of rubbing seemed to have attracted the attention of the man in white opposite.

His hand slightly let go of the door handle, and his arms drooped, giving a feeling that he would turn around at any time.

Lin Sheng licked his lips and put the Wooden Shield in front of him. He held the Great Sword tightly, ready to use it at any time.

Huff … huff … huff … huff …

He heard the man in front of him panting. That kind of panting was like a person who suddenly encountered something extremely frightening. His whole body was sweating, and his breathing was extremely nervous.

Click.

Suddenly, there was a crisp sound.

The security door opposite opened.

The man slowly walked in through the opened door, and then the security door closed. A crisp cracking sound could be heard.

From beginning to end, he did not face Lin Sheng.

Lin Sheng frowned. He lifted his shield and walked out slowly.

He planned to explore the surroundings. Let's see if there's anything strange around here.

Bam!

Suddenly, the anti-theft door on the opposite side opened.

Two people in white clothes, a man and a woman, were staring at him with pale faces and smiling.

These two people were Auntie Chen and her husband who lived in his house.

Lin Sheng was stunned.

In the blink of an eye, he pulled the door open and slammed it shut. Then, the Wooden Shield was firmly pressed against the security door.

Boom!!!

In an instant, there were two loud bangs.

The anti-theft door that had just been closed suddenly twisted.

Lin Sheng was knocked a few steps back by a huge force and almost lost his footing.

"Saint Blood Ignition!!" His heart was raging, and with a low roar, his body swelled up a bit. He raised his double-edged greatsword and stabbed at the door.

At this moment, the anti-theft door was also smashed by the huge impact from outside.

Bam!!!

The flying iron door crashed into the charging Lin Sheng.

The tip of the greatsword pierced straight into the iron door, making an ear-piercing noise.

Lin Sheng felt as if his sword had pierced through the iron door and hit something. That thing was extremely hard, like a rock or a wooden stake.

The huge impact was accompanied by a fierce recoil.

Even though Lin Sheng's hand was holding the hilt tightly, he still felt a pain in his hand. His whole body was sent flying by the huge impact.

Bam!

His back hit the wall, and he spat out a mouthful of blood.

The thing behind the door did not seem to feel good either. With a clang, it dropped the iron door and turned into two white shadows, flashed through the stairwell, and disappeared into the anti-theft door on the opposite side.

Click.

The anti-theft door on the opposite side slowly closed and locked.

"Hey …" Lin Sheng straightened his body, leaning on his sword, his face showing a hint of bravery.

"Does this count as a lose-lose situation?" He squeezed out a smile, forced a few steps forward, and stood firm.

Then, he activated the Saint Power in his body and began to heal from the impact.

This was the convenience of mastering Saint Power. He could use it at any time, anywhere, to speed up the recovery of his body's injuries.

After recovering a little, Lin Sheng was no longer afraid.

Carrying his Shieldsword, he strode into the stairwell.

There was no light in the dark stairwell.

There were only two oddly dark stairwells, one above and one below.

"Let's go down and take a look." While his Saint Blood was burning, Lin Sheng sped up and walked down the stairs.

But after a few steps, he felt that something was wrong.

This stairwell seemed to be a little too long …

Normally, the stairs in his house should have 13 steps, but he had already walked up to 20 steps, and it was still not over.

Moreover …

Lin Sheng tilted his head, and carefully looked to his left and right.

Using the red light from his house, he quickly discovered the problem.

There were no handrails on either side of the stairs!

In the darkness, there was only a flight of stairs that slowly extended downwards.

To his left and right was a boundless, bottomless darkness.

From afar, Lin Sheng seemed to be standing in a vast dark space, and the stairs under his feet were the only solid ground in this space …

"This damned place …!?" Lin Sheng quickly retreated back to his house's door. Cautiously, he looked at the house opposite him, and then turned his gaze to the stairwell upstairs.

Without thinking too much, he picked up his Shieldsword and began to walk up the stairs.

He went up one floor after another.

The doors of the two houses on each floor were tightly shut.

But what surprised Lin Sheng was that the higher he went, the older the anti-theft doors became.

The higher the doors, the more patterns there seemed to be engravings on them. They were very ancient patterns.

But because it was too dark, he could not see clearly what they were.

He went all the way up four floors.

Lin Sheng stopped and looked down.

The red light from his house's door was still faintly discernible. This calmed him down a little.

He had just been ambushed there, but just because there was light, he inexplicably felt more at ease there than anywhere else.

"Human phototaxis …" Lin Sheng chuckled inwardly. He simply activated the Saint power in his body, and a circle of light appeared on the edge of the Wooden Shield.

This was simply infusing Saint power on the edge of the Wooden Shield. It did not consume much energy, and it could be used as a light source for a long time.

With the white light, the surroundings suddenly became much clearer.

In the stairwell, the walls were covered with moss.

The mottled walls were peeling off here and there, revealing the light-colored walls inside.

The light in the middle was not a modern incandescent lamp, but a retro oil lamp in a black glass box.

The anti-theft doors on both sides were not normal doors either.

They were all covered with dense and thick rust stains. It seemed that these two anti-theft doors had not been opened for many years.

Lin Sheng thought about it and looked to the left.

The anti-theft door on the left was obviously more rusty than the other side.

Lin Sheng raised his Wooden Shield and was about to use it to open the door.

Suddenly …

Click.

The door in front of him opened a gap!
